PUBG Mobile has announced a collaboration with K-pop group BABYMONSTER ahead of the game’s seventh anniversary.
According to a release, PUBG Mobile players can earn in-game rewards inspired by the idol group and participate in other interactive gameplay elements on the Erangel and Rondo maps. The event will last until May 6th.
Additionally, players will be able to take photos with their favourite BABYMONSTER member in a photo booth at the centre of each area. Fans can also play the K-pop group’s music by equipping themselves with the BABYMONSTER-branded cassette player.
The collaboration seems to be fully focused on in-game activations, with no esports-focused content announced.
Formed under YG Entertainment in 2023, the K-pop group consists of seven members – three South Koreans (Ahyeon, Rami, Rora), two Japanese (Ruka, Asa) and two Thai (Pharita, Chiquita).
Throughout the past few years, there have been several collaborations in the esports and gaming space featuring K-pop artists. Back in 2022, Blackpink released a collaborative track with PUBG Mobile, ‘Ready For Love’. New Jeans (now known as NJZ) worked on the 2023 League of Legends World Championship anthem, ‘Gods’ and performed live during the Grand Final match in South Korea.
Earlier this year, FPS shooter Overwatch 2 and LE SSERAFIM collaborated on the release of brand-new skins and cosmetics after their first successful partnership back in 2023. Other artists such as KISS OF LIFE and THE BOYZ have also been involved in esports-focused projects.
